Prevalence of anemia among non-pregnant women in Togo
Togo: Prevalence of anemia among non-pregnant women was 40.5% in 2023. ▼ Falling
Prevalence of anemia among non-pregnant women in Togo, 2000–2023
Source: Global Health Observatory Data Repository/World Health Statistics, World Health Organization (WHO). Measured in % of women ages 15-49.
Analysis
Togo recorded 40.5% for prevalence of anemia among non-pregnant women in 2023.
That represents a change of up 1.2% on the previous year and up 0.2% over ten years.
Over the whole period, prevalence of anemia among non-pregnant women in Togo peaked at 46.9% in 2000 and was at its lowest, 39.5%, in 2018.
Togo ranks 26th of 192 countries on this measure, in the top quarter.
The long-run direction has been consistently falling across the 24 years of available data.

About this data
Prevalence of anemia, non-pregnant women, is the percentage of non-pregnant women whose hemoglobin level is less than 120 grams per liter at sea level.
